My philosophy and daily habits

Here are a few things I do that I believe anyone can adopt to look relaxed and feel their best:

  • Get plenty of sleep: I almost never wake up to an alarm clock, so I always make sure I get enough rest.
  • No alcohol or coffee: I don’t drink alcohol and only very occasionally have a decaf coffee.
  • Stay active: I move a lot and make sure to stay active. I aim for 10.000 steps a day and do three hours of workout per week with my online personal trainer.
  • Hydrate: I drink plenty of water, green tea and herbal tea (never soft drinks) although I’d like to hydrate even more.
  • Healthy eating: I eat reasonably healthy: lots of fresh veggies and plenty of protein (I aim for at least 100 grams per day). My only downfall is my love for sweets, especially cookies and local treats
  • Control over life: Having control over your life, yet knowing when to surrender to the current reality and feeling free is crucial.
  • Laugh often: Smiling genuinely hides any wrinkles or small imperfections. It’s the best way to look good, and everyone can start doing it today.

Eyelash and eyebrow tint

My eyelashes and eyebrows are naturally blonde, so without mascara my face looks quite expressionless. When I participated in Survivor in 2005, I had them tinted for the first time. Waking up with a bit of expression in my face was such a relief that I have kept doing it ever since. I used to go to a salon every few weeks, but now I do it myself because it is so easy.

I use Berrywell Augenblick 3 Natural Brown and the Berrywell Cream Developer 10 Volume 3 percent. I mix one centimeter of paint with four drops of hydrogen peroxide, blend it well and apply it carefully with a small brush. I remove it after one minute to see how my hair and skin react and repeat until the color is right. For me it lasts about six weeks.
